5136 N Nottingham Ave, Chicago“As a family, we like going to mass here. My kids have been attending the Religious Education program for many years. My youngest has been there since Kindergarten. Yes, they offer R.E. for Kindergarteners. Even after receiving the sacrament of First Communion, they offer continuing R.E. classes up to and including confirmation. Many parishes that I know of only offer the preparation for First Communion and preparation for Confirmation but nothing in between those spiritual and faith formative years.”
